WEST ORANGE COMMUNITY HOUSE AND BOYS AND GIRLS CLUB INC, founded in 1919, is a community nonprofit in the Recreation & Sports sector that reported $3.7M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. The organization ran a surplus of $1.0M, a strong 28% operating margin.

Mission

EDCUATIONAL AND SOCIAL PROGRAMS TO LOW INCOME FAMILIES EARLY PRESCHOOL EDUCATIONAL PROGRAMS INCLUDING CHILDCARE. BEOFRE AND AFTER SCHOOL PROGRAMS FOR SCHOOL AGE CHILDREN
